💭 The equine industry relies on a vast spectrum of talent, and needs more than riders and grooms.

Behind every successful equestrian brand, event, retailer, manufacturer, college, and organisation are professionals driving sales, marketing, operations, customer service and innovation.

The future of our industry depends on attracting talented people into commercial careers that help equestrian businesses grow.

At Equine Careers, we’re proud to support both employers and candidates by showcasing the wide range of professional opportunities available within the equine sector.

Because a career in horses can mean far more than working outside.

In recent years the most common but hardest role to fill would be roles in E commerce - they require a certain set of IT and Tech based skills, which don't always marry with someone with an understanding of horses and the terminology we use.
So my best advice - gain those skills and become really useful to the industry.

❓Where did the idea of Equine Careers come from ?

At School myself the careers advice I was offered was severely lacking, once you mentioned horses - people did not know what to offer you.
After working on the practical side (Groom for Derek Ricketts and on a Point to Point yard) I completed a business studies degree before securing a role as Sales & Marketing Manager for an equestrian surfacing company. Here I was the first point of contact and got involved in all areas of the business. We supplied the surface for Your Horse Live and I got to meet loads of famous people when I did site visits and we installed new surfaces and facilities.
I was made redundant from this role in 2008 so had time on my hands, I wanted a similar job but where to find it ? So from here the idea of Equine Careers was born - a jobs board for office and commercial roles.
So with all the contacts I had made in my previous role I set about getting a website built and the rest is history.

❓What is the busiest part of my day ?

That would be conducting careers coaching sessions, uploading jobs and interviewing / shortlisting for clients.

❓Whats the best piece of advice I can offer people planning a career in the Industry ?

Do the leg work, get to know people, network, work at events, get involved, volunteer and get stuck in - no matter that that looks like. Gain experience and been keen to learn and work your way up. Don't rely on social media. Face to face is key.
